Bennet: Trump should donate profits from other facets of business empire
U.S. Sen. Michael Bennet is challenging President Donald Trump’s pledge to donate all profits from foreign governments patronizing his hotels to the U.S. Treasury, noting all the businesses bearing the president’s name should fall under the commitment. In a letter sent last week to White House Counsel Donald McGahn, his third to the Trump administration…

Sean Spicer ‘needs to go’ says Rep. Mike Coffman at town hall
Showing no partisan love for embattled White House Press Secretary Sean Spicer, U.S. Rep. Mike Coffman, R-Aurora, told the sometimes angry, confrontational audience in his first Trump-era town hall meeting Wednesday night that Spicer should step down. “He needs to go,” Coffman said of Spicer. The comment arrived like a crescendo in the nearly two-hour long town…
